Todays delivery !!!! The Martini Mk 22 Renault. Tamiya’s number 14 model.
I only ever saw this car in the Tamiya catalogues I’d never seen one in the flesh until today. I like it.
 
After going through the box of assorted bits that came with it, although there’s always a lot of random rubbish in them, it did contain the differential gears and some plastic wheel stopper bits.
I already knew it had the gear box, rear wheels and a tyre.
 

With the body off.
Luckily I have the metal plates the hjservos attach to. The speed controller is the one used in the Sand Rover, so there’s a good chance I’ve got one of those.
As luck would have it I’ve got an axle in the post as well. 
Although I’m missing a tyre, I might put the sponge ones on that came with the F1 chassis which is going to become a Ligier.
I might even be tempted to Nick the front wheels and tyres off this for the Ligier build.
 

And here’s all the stuff which is mostly of no use and will be going into my box of “ crap “.
There does appear to be a full set of Sand Rover gears, some resistors and a 380 motor with the metal motor plate used in the original Subaru Brat. I’m sure there’s some other useful stuff, but there’s still a lot of trash.
